HISTORY
The Millennium Composers Initiative was founded by composers Josh Trentadue and Duncan Petersen-Jones in 2018. Comprising 39 members across the globe, MCI supports and represents young composers at the beginning of their professional careers, regardless of their aesthetic, style, or background.
MCI has collaborated with artists and ensembles across the United States to foster new creative opportunities for our members and stimulate the growth of new music in vitally important communities. We have additionally represented our members at events including The Midwest Clinic International Band and Orchestra Conference, and the North American Saxophone Alliance Conference. The members of MCI have additionally received representation, award recognition, commission and collaborative opportunities, and more from world-renowned publishing companies, festivals, conferences, competitions, ensembles, and artists. |
